1.5Mb/256Kb for $79.97/month + $299.00 equipment fee

or

6.0Mb/608Kb for $34.99/month + $0.00 equipment fee.

Over twice as expensive for 1/4 the speed, and let's not mention that little 3 initial "F" word. Living "in the middle of nowhere" sure is expensive. But why is my phone service charge the same as someone living in the middle of say, Detroit? *rant* And why does the phone company have a RT (that was installed 2 years ago,) 1500 feet from my house, with no DSL?? Maybe they drove around the area and saw countless DirecWay/HughesNet and Wildblue dishes on homes and said to themselves "how will we ever compete with that!" I dunno, just seems odd. Perhaps they're just too busy trying to provide TV service to people who already have multiple options. Or maybe it's because they're too busy trying to fight off muni-projects. *rant over*

yup, I'm in a similar situation; I'm 4250 feet from one RT (sadly, not lit with DSL yet), so, when ADSL2/ADSL2+ is deployed, I'll be able to get really nice speeds...but, that's just the problem, the RT isn't lit yet.

Either way, I have EVDO Revision A, too, and I have been very very happy with it; a fairly consistent 1250-1280k down and 200-250k up (would be around triple this, but the router limits upload speed...it's just a bug) with a ping of around 100ms to www.google.com.

If I play on the right gaming server for Battlefield 2, I can get a ping around 150-160 ms; not the greatest in the world, but it sure beats dial-up!

I just can't wait until Sprint optimizes their network next year to allow gaming and VoIP applications to get the necessary latency they need. (and EVDO can have a ping around 60-70 ms, so that's pretty doggone good).
